Useful tips for train travellers
• On your train journey from Bordeaux to Copenhagen, the primary operators include SNCF and DB (Deutsche Bahn). Both provide catering services onboard, with SNCF offering a bistro service featuring French snacks and beverages, while DB typically has a dining car with options for light meals, coffee, and pastries. Check out their respective websites for updates on catering availability during your journey: SNCF - ">">sncf.com DB - ">">bahn.com
• Depending on the operator you choose, seating options may vary. For instance, SNCF offers options like 1st Class (more spacious and quieter) and standard 2nd Class (comfortable yet economical). DB generally offers First Class, Business Class, and Economy Class seats. First Class typically provides larger seats, power outlets, and complimentary snacks and drinks. It's advisable to book your tickets in advance, as you can secure a seat that fits your comfort needs.
• Upon arriving at Copenhagen Central Station (København H), you will find ample facilities. The station has luggage storage services where you can leave your bags, and you'll also have access to restrooms, including showers in the nearby hotel facilities. To get to the city center quickly, take the S-Tog (urban rail). Line A or Line E will take you directly to stations like Nørreport or Copenhagen Central station in just a few minutes.
